1. Which of the followings are the major benefits of implementing virtual LAN? Choose any three.
Answer: Option A, B, and D Explanation: The correct options are A, B, and D.
The major benefits of implementing VLAN are breaking a single broadcast domain into multiple broadcast domains, enhancing network security and allowing a logical grouping of users by functions. But, VLAN doesn’t increase the size of the collision domain.

7. Which of the following are the VLAN trunking protocols? Choose two.
Answer: Option A and D Explanation: The correct options are A and D.
IEEE 802.1 q and ISL are the two main VLAN trunking protocols. ISL is the Cisco proprietory. 802.1q is created by IEEE.
